While her famous last name may suggest radio play more than ready-to-wear, designer Stella McCartney has proved herself as an established talent in the fashion world. After graduating from Central St. Martin’s esteemed fashion program in 1995, McCartney served as Creative Director of Chloe before launching her namesake line in 2001. Her shoes, handbag and clothing collections are known for fine tailoring, strong femininity, and an ethical point of view. Because of the designer’s commitment to the environment and animal rights, she excludes leather and fur from all her collections and often works with organic and eco-friendly materials.
